Put the verbs in brackets into the Present, Past or Future Indefinite Tense.

10-11 класс

A. 1. We always (to consult) a dictionary when we (to translate) texts.

2. We (to take part) in a sport competition last Sunday.

3. My friend (to pass) entrance examinations to the University last month.

4. He (to study) at the Law Department now.

5. He (to graduate) from the University in five years and will become a lawyer.

6. The students (to come) to the lectures every day. 7. We (not to go) to the country this Sunday.

1. We always consult a dictionary when we translate texts.
2. We took part in a sport competition last Sunday.
3. My friend passed entrance examinations to the University last month.
4. He is studying at the Law Department now.
5. He will graduate from the University in five years and will become a lawyer.
6. The students come to the lectures every day. 

7. We are not going to the country this Sunday.
